+| Key | Required | Notes |
+|:------------------:|:--------:|----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------|
+| pipeline_id | ✔️ Yes | related Domain Layer `cicd_pipelines.id`, it's optional before v1.0.0-beta8. |
+| environment | ✖️ No | the environment this deployment happens. For example, `PRODUCTION` `STAGING` `TESTING` `DEVELOPMENT`.
The default value is `PRODUCTION` |
+| repo_url | ✔️ Yes | the repo URL of the deployment commit
If there is a row in the domain layer table `repos` where `repos.url` equals `repo_url`, the `repoId` will be filled with `repos.id`. |
+| repo_id | ✖️ No | related Domain Layer `repos.id`
No default value. |
+| name | ✖️ No | deployment name. The default value is "deployment for `request.commit_sha`" |
+| display_title | ✖️ No | deployment display_title. No default value. |
+| ref_name | ✖️ No | related branch/tag
No default value. |
+| commit_sha | ✔️ Yes | the sha of the deployment commit |
+| commit_msg | ✖️ No | the sha of the deployment commit message |
+| create_time | ✖️ No | Time. Eg. 2020-01-01T12:00:00+00:00
No default value. |
+| start_time | ✔️ Yes | Time. Eg. 2020-01-01T12:00:00+00:00
No default value. |
+| end_time | ✖️ No | Time. Eg. 2020-01-01T12:00:00+00:00
The default value is the time when DevLake receives the POST request. |
+| result | ✖️ No | deployment result, one of the values : `SUCCESS`, `FAILURE`, `ABORT`, `MANUAL`,
The default value is `SUCCESS`. |
+| deployment_commits | ✖ No | Allow deployment webhook to push deployments to multiple repos in one request, includes display_title,repo_url,commit_sha,commit_msg,name,ref_name. |
